## Changelog — Font vendoring defaults changed

As of this release, the Bracken UI build no longer fetches third-party fonts at build time. All typefaces used by the Lanternwell suite are now vendored into the repo under a dedicated assets directory, and the fetch step is skipped by default. If you're onboarding, nothing to install — the fonts travel with the checkout. The build flags controlling this behavior are listed below.

settings of hadup-yafog:
LAMAEL_PIN=3761
LAMAEL_TENANT=istmir
LAMAEL_METRICS_HOST=metrics.lamael.plorvasys.test
LAMAEL_SEAL=seal_8ea68500
LAMAEL_STANDBY_TEAM=fraok

## Onboarding: Gridsmith Crossword Generator

Gridsmith builds daily puzzles for the Lark & Letter app. Pipeline: wordlist scoring, fill solver, clue draft, editor review. New engineers get read access day one; solver write access after the first sync. Builds run nightly; failures page whoever owns the week. For the shared puzzle-archive locker, sign in with the recovery passphrase below.

unlock words, yawig-kagef: gordor-holvan-ulaael-pramir-ulaiel-tamdor

Quick refresher for the sync: Hopvine's webhook deliverer retries on any 5xx with exponential backoff, capped at six attempts over roughly two hours. 4xx means we stop immediately — don't ask us to retry your auth bugs. Each attempt carries the same delivery ID, so dedupe on your side, not ours. Provenance-wise, every delivery envelope is stamped with the build that produced it, which lets us bisect regressions fast. For reference, the current stamped build identifier is below.

pipeline stamp: htk9_ce63042d9

Subject: Customer concentration — we need to talk

Team, quick flag before Thursday's board session. Harwick Logistics now accounts for 44% of Redlane revenue, up from 31% last year. Great customer, but if their renewal wobbles we have a real problem. I've asked Delia to model downside scenarios and Tomas to accelerate the mid-market pipeline in the Estmere region. Nothing alarming yet, just prudent. Our mitigation hinges on the plan noted below.

management briefing: The renewal with Zoraelax Group closes at $10 million a year, 15 percent below the last contract. Project Ralael slips by six weeks because of the audit delay.